Sympathy and the Human Connection
This chapter explores the evolution of the word 'sympathy' and its implications for human relationships, contrasting historical and modern interpretations. It delves into the tension between individualism in contemporary society and the desire for deeper connections, utilizing the insights of William Blake and critiques of consumerism. The discussion highlights the importance of imagination and inner experience in fostering genuine engagement with the world and reconnecting with both humanity and nature.
